See http://www.xmlmind.com/xmleditor/persoedition.html > > I’d like to try to generate an HTML Help from a freeware HTML compiler > (for example HTML Help Workshop). > > In the XML Editor Personal Edition, how to previously process my DITA > XML files or map with an XSL stylesheet? > > Looking forward to hearing from you soon... > > Thank you in advance for your attention. > You have two ways to do that: [1] Use XMLmind XSL Utility Personal Edition. More information: http://www.xmlmind.com/foconverter/xsl_utility.html Download it from this page: http://www.xmlmind.com/foconverter/downloadperso.shtml#xslutil OR [2] Temporarily transform your Personal Edition into an Evaluation Edition (which has the "Convert Document" submenu) by getting an evaluation key and installing it in your Personal Edition. See http://www.xmlmind.com/xmleditor/evaluate.html --> In both cases, please do not forget to ``declare'' hhc.exe (part of HTML Help Workshop) to the application you use: [1] Please use button Preferences, "Helper applications" section. See http://www.xmlmind.com/foconverter/_distrib/doc/help/com.xmlmind.guiutil.PreferencesEditorDialog.html#helper_applications_preferences OR [2] Please use Options|Preferences, "Tools|Helper applications" section.
